Student Demographics & Diversity
Below you’ll find the diversity of Pharmacology & Toxicology graduates at Northeastern University, by degree type.
Program-wide, Pharmacology & Toxicology graduates at Northeastern University are 50% women (10) and 50% men (10).
Pharmacology & Toxicology Master’s Program at Northeastern University
Among the 15 master’s pharmacology & toxicology degrees awarded at Northeastern University, 53% were women (8) and 47% were men (7).
The following table and chart show the race/ethnicity of Pharmacology & Toxicology master’s degree recipients at Northeastern University.
| Race / Ethnicity | Number of Graduates |
|---|---|
| White | 2 |
| Hispanic / Latino | 2 |
| Black / African American | 1 |
| Asian | 1 |
| International (Nonresident) | 9 |
Minority students account for 27% of Pharmacology & Toxicology master’s degree recipients at Northeastern University, lower than the national average of 28%.*
Pharmacology & Toxicology Doctoral Program at Northeastern University
Among the 5 doctoral pharmacology & toxicology graduates at Northeastern University, 40% were women (2) and 60% were men (3).
The following table and chart show the race/ethnicity of Pharmacology & Toxicology doctoral degree recipients at Northeastern University.
| Race / Ethnicity | Number of Graduates |
|---|---|
| White | 2 |
| International (Nonresident) | 3 |
*The racial-ethnic minorities figure is the total number of graduates minus White, international (nonresident), and unknown-race graduates.
